How to Upgrade to Webba 5?
There are a few ways to upgrade to Webba 5:
Automatic Update
If you have enabled automatic plugin updates, the transition to the latest version will be seamless. Your website will automatically update to Version 5, ensuring you’re always using the latest features and improvements.

Manual Update
For those who prefer manual control over updates, simply navigate to the WordPress plugin page, and initiate the update process. It’s a straightforward process that ensures you have complete control over the timing of the update.

Premium Users
If you are a Premium user and the instructions above don’t work for you, go to the WordPress dashboard and navigate to Webba Booking –> Account and next to the “Version”, click on the “Install Update Now” button.

What to do after updating to Webba 5?
To ensure a smooth transition, here are some essential steps to take after updating to Webba 5:
Update your shortcodes
To ensure that your new booking form displays correctly, it’s essential to replace the old shortcodes with the new ones. You can find the updated shortcodes in our documentation, but will only be valid once Webba 5 is launched. Meanwhile, continue to utilize the existing shortcodes.
Rename translation files
For those who have customized translations for your booking system, there’s a crucial adjustment to make.
In the new Webba 5 version, the text domain is changed to “webba-booking-lite.” When the new update will be launched, here’s how to adapt your custom translations, using Spanish translations as an example:
- Before: wbk-es_ES.mo, wbk-es_ES.po
- After: webba-booking-lite-es_ES.mo, webba-booking-lite-es_ES.po

How to Downgrade Back to Webba 4?
If you’ve ended up updating the plugin to Webba 5 and, for any reason, wish to revert to Webba 4, here are the steps to follow:
PRO Version Users:
Step 1: Download the Previous Version
For PRO users, access your account on Freemius at https://users.freemius.com/. If you’ve forgotten your password, you can reset it using the email address associated with your purchase.
Step 2: Navigate to the Download Section
Once logged in, navigate to the “Download” section within your Freemius account.

Step 3: Choose Version 4.5.33 and Download:
In the “Download” section of your Freemius account, select version 4.5.33 and click on the “Download” button to obtain the previous version of the Webba Booking plugin.

Step 4: Delete Your Current Version and Install Downloaded:
Remove your current version of the Webba Booking plugin. Then, install the downloaded version (4.5.33) to replace it.
Free Version Users:
Step 1: Download the Previous Version:
If you’re using the free version, follow these steps:
- Access the advanced page.
- Scroll down and choose version 4.5.33.
- Click on the “Download” button to obtain the previous version of the plugin.

Step 2: Install the plugin
Install the plugin in the WordPress Plugin section.
Step 3: Open the Settings Page – Backup Options
Once the previous version is installed, access the plugin’s settings page. Look for the “Backup options” section.
In the dropdown menu within the “Backup options” section, select a date that precedes the update you want to revert. Click on “Restore settings values.” This will revert your settings to their state before the update.
